  Even with the holiday break, there are some new programs to watch on the Community Channel. “What’s Cooking, Revere?” is a RevereTV produced program that offers up the kitchen studio to community members to show off personal recipes. Longtime community member Diana Cardona made honey sweet salmon last week. This episode premiered last Wednesday at 7 p.m. and will be scheduled on the Community Channel over the next few weeks. Watch it at any time in the respective playlist on YouTube. RTV’s YouTube page is where you will find all past episodes of “What’s Cooking, Revere?” If you are interested in learning more new recipes, check out “Cooking Made Simple,” “Fabulous Foods with Victoria Fabb,” and “Cooking with the Keefes.”

  RevereTV will be covering one basketball game every week, dubbing it “The Game of the Week.” The latest game is RHS Girls Basketball vs. Milton from yesterday. The previous two games were Boys Basketball vs. Everett and then Lynn English. “The Game of the Week” streams live on the Community Channel, YouTube and Facebook. Games on YouTube may then be taken off social media until the end of the season.

  RTV GOV is still scheduled with the latest local government meetings. There is not much going on this week, but last week’s meetings are now replaying. The list includes Revere City Council, License Commission, Public Art Commission and the Revere Public Schools Community Meeting on Opioids and Fentanyl. These meetings will be replaying on RTV GOV over the next few weeks. RTV GOV is channel 9 on Comcast and 13/613 on RCN.
